About the role
Summary
Evaluates, identifies, and provides services to students who meet eligibility requirements for occupational therapy; Works collaboratively and communicates with professionals and parents regarding integration of occupational therapy goals into classroom and home environment; Adheres to all federal, state, and local proceduresEssential Duties
- Maintains accurate, complete, and appropriate records and files reports promptly
- Demonstrates accurate and up-to-date knowledge of content Identifies students exhibiting fine motor or sensory processing disorders through evaluation and analyzing deficits in motor skills of students found in the identification process
- Participates in IEP meetings in order to relate pertinent data used in the determination of students’ needs
- Appropriately schedules students
- Provides consultative services to teachers, parents, administrators, and allied agencies in order to address fine motor goals into the classroom, other education programs, and the home environment
- Evaluates and reports student progress for continuation or termination of services
- Participates with school administration/coordinators for effective planning, coordination, and implementation of occupational therapy program into the total education system
- Adheres to professional, ethical, and legal standards of practice
- Adheres to all District policies and procedures
- Performs other duties as assigned by the appropriate administrator
